Hello there,
I want to write a code in matlab that finds a real solution for the equation x^3+x^2+x+7=0 , -5<x<5, using Genetic Algorithms.
How can I implement that with code?

f = @(x) x.^4-2*x.^3+3*x.^2+x-4
target = 5;
residue = @(x) (f(x)-target).^2
[bestx, fval] = ga(residue, 1)
roots([1, -2, 3, 1, -4-target])
